Be socially responsible, and cut your home energy usage by unplugging your electronic chargers when they are not in use. Chargers for devices like phones, mp3 players, computers and others use small amounts of power any time they are in an outlet, regardless of whether you are actually charging the device.

Wash your clothes with cold water whenever possible. Almost 90 percent of the consumed energy while washing your clothes is spent on heating the water for a warm or hot cycle. If your detergent is of good quality, cold water is effective.

Use a tankless water heater instead of a tank. Tankless water heaters do require energy for operation, but since they heat water on demand, rather than heating a tank of water that you’re not always using. Tankless heaters can supply the entire house or a single faucet with hot water.

Wash clothes in cold water whenever possible.Almost ninety percent of the power you use to do laundry is simply used to heat the water for a warm or hot cycle. As long as the washing detergent you use is reliable, cold water washing can be just as effective as warm water.

Use a laptop for your computing needs rather than a desktop computer. Laptops use up to 75% less electricity than desktops, especially if the desktop is being used for the Internet or software programs. The laptop is also mobile, so it can be taken anywhere!
